boot hill

noun

sometimes capitalized B&H
West
: a burial-ground especially for men killed in gunfights
as a wild town in early days, it had its boot hill and knew … notorious gunfightersAmerican Guide Series: Texas

Word History

Etymology

so called from the supposition that most persons buried there died with their boots on
